
Flathead River
The cool weather has kept the local Flathead fishable for nearly the entire month of April. As of now, she is still good to go but spring could blow out our local river any day. Still nymphing deep, dry dropper also effective... but March browns have been making an appearance for some excellent dry fly fishing. Chubby. PT jig dropper. Size 12-10 your favorite parachute for March brown. If going deep. Stones and pink stuff!

Missouri River
Most trips are taking place over on the mighty MO. Flows are already up! Today we're at just over 5800. Super great spring flows, it is nice to see after the last couple of years! Nymphing 9-10 ft. Sow bugs above Craig and most of the river. But below Craig, mayfly stuff is starting to work. There are some fish up. Look close! Streamer guys are having success chucking something white.
